One of the most popular ornamental plants worldwide, roses (Rosa sp.), are very susceptible to Botrytis gray mold disease. The necrotrophic infection of rose petals by B. cinerea causes the collapse and death of these tissues in both the growth and post-harvest stages, resulting in serious economic losses.

Pectobacterium spp. are necrotrophic bacterial plant pathogens of the family Pectobacteriaceae, responsible for a wide spectrum of diseases of important crops and ornamental plants including soft rot, blackleg, and stem wilt. P. carotovorum is a genetically heterogeneous species consisting of three valid subspecies, P. carotovorum subsp. brasiliense (Pcb), P. carotovorum subsp. carotovorum (Pcc), and P. carotovorum subsp. odoriferum (Pco).

The phytohormone ethylene plays a central role in development and senescence of climacteric flowers. In ornamental plant production, ethylene sensitive plants are usually protected against negative effects of ethylene by application of chemical inhibitors. In Campanula, flowers are sensitive to even minute concentrations of ethylene.

Colour patterns are the most distinct phenotypic traits in the majority of the living organism including fishes and considered as one of the main influencing factors in consumers’ buying decisions. Color traits are regulated by mainly four types of pigments stored in chromatophores. Melanin, is one of the most important pigment of cells, responsible for the coloration. Tyrosinase is a characteristics enzyme in melanin biosynthesis. Modulation of tyrosinase is of significance in the ornamental fish industry, food fishes as well as in humans.

Gladiolus (Gladiolus hybrida) is an important ornamental plant cultivated world over for its attractive spikes. The commercial cultivation of Gladiolus is based on natural multiplication of corms and cormels. In vitro propagation techniques, is superior to conventional propagation and produces disease free plants in huge quantities. In vitro regeneration of gladiolus cultivars, Sylvia, White Prosperity and Amsterdam was achieved using shoot bud of cormels as an explant. Sylvia variety recorded the best for callus induction and regeneration than other two varieties.

An MS-based metabolomic approach was used to profile the secondary metabolite of the ornamental plant Erythrina lysistemon via ultra-performance liquid chromatography coupled to photodiode array detection and high resolution q-TOF mass spectrometry (UPLC-PDA-MS). Cultures maintained the capacity to produce E. lysistemon flavonoid subclasses with pterocarpans amounting for the most abundant ones suggesting that it could provide a resource of such flavonoid subclass. In contrast, alkaloids, major constituents of Erythrina genus, were detected at trace levels in suspension cultures.
